KENT v. DEPT. OF CORRECTIONS

No. 2017 CA 1761.

264 So.3d 514 (2018)

Tracy Billy KENT v. DEPARTMENT OF CORRECTIONS.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, First Circuit.

Judgment Rendered: October 17, 2018.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Tracy Kent, Kinder, LA, In Proper Person, Plaintiff/Appellant.

William L. Kline , Baton Rouge, LA, Counsel for Defendant/Appellee, Louisiana Department of Public Safety and Corrections.

BEFORE: GUIDRY, PETTIGREW, WELCH, CRAIN, AND PENZATO, JJ.


An inmate appeals the dismissal of his petition for judicial review contesting the computation of his sentence by the Louisiana Department of Public Safety and Corrections (DPSC). For the following reasons, we vacate the district court's judgment and remand this matter with instructions.
